Big Money and Endorsements Shape Maryland Primaries
from Annapolis News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Maryland’s primaries delivered a clear message: incumbents and establishment favorites are still king, with Wes Moore set for a gubernatorial rematch and Adrian Boafo, backed by crypto and AIPAC super PACs, cruising to victory. Big money moved the needle—sports gambling PACs, crypto donors, and endorsements from Moore and Scott all played decisive roles. Meanwhile, social media clout didn’t guarantee wins, as Bobby LaPin’s online buzz couldn’t overcome a fundraising gap.
